Senior Manager of Quality Engineering

Job Description:

The Role:
Entegris is on the lookout for a Senior Manager of Quality Engineering to be part of our dynamic team. This pivotal leadership position reports directly to the Site Director and is responsible for managing a dedicated team of Quality Engineers and Lab Technicians, as well as individual contributors in Quality Engineering.

The team collaborates with various stakeholders to enhance manufacturing quality and optimize product yield. This role encompasses overseeing, guiding, and delivering both technical and strategic direction within a continuous manufacturing environment.

Key responsibilities include ensuring adequate support for manufacturing processes, addressing staffing needs, escalating issues, and driving operational goals aligned with the overall business strategy.


Key Responsibilities:


Lead the engineering team, providing both technical and strategic guidance to define, maintain, and enhance manufacturing processes while standardizing practices across shifts.

Collaborate with the Product Engineering Team to establish quality requirements for new products. Facilitate local New Product Introduction (NPI) processes and the commercialization of innovative products.

Minimize variation in product and process parameters by identifying critical contributors to variation and implementing effective control systems.

Manage site quality through MRB, DRB completion, audit support, quality lab operations, and customer complaint investigations to meet responsiveness expectations.

Oversee product and non-product root-cause investigations and customer communications utilizing statistical analysis and engineering expertise, driving effective corrective and preventative actions.

Guide and develop personnel to enhance individual and organizational performance through performance-based management, including goal setting, coaching, training, and feedback.

Establish strong working relationships with EH&S, Customer Quality Engineering, Production, R&D, Sourcing, Planning, and both internal and external stakeholders to ensure timely execution of business plans.

Maintain awareness of plant business activities and drive necessary actions to uphold plant integrity. Facilitate site tours and audits (Customer, ISO, Business, etc.). Supervise operational and quality performance, improving systems, processes, and best practices.

Prioritize project schedules based on customer and business needs, considering risks, benefits, equipment efficiency, resource availability, and material supply.

Drive continuous improvement for key performance metrics (EH&S, productivity, quality, plant efficiency) while ensuring the integrity of product and quality systems data is upheld.
Ensure a robust training program is in place.

Provide guidance and training to staff, fostering team development to achieve goals, motivating individuals to deliver results, and recruiting high-quality talent.

Maintain and enhance cross-functional team relationships, working collaboratively to identify and resolve production and engineering challenges.
Ensure adherence to policies and processes, defining training requirements and ensuring teams are fully equipped.

What We Seek:
A Bachelor's degree in Mechanical, Polymer, Chemical, Material Engineering, or a related discipline, or equivalent experience.

7+ years of experience in manufacturing and leading a Quality Engineering function within a manufacturing setting, ideally in a high-tech, high-volume product line.

Demonstrated proficiency in quality, operations, development, or applications engineering.
Strong communication skills at various organizational levels.

A strategic mindset with a vision for the future, coupled with the experience to execute plans effectively.

Engineering knowledge and experience in manufacturing, quality systems, and systematic problem-solving.

Outstanding Candidates Will Have:


Proven experience in the semiconductor or polymer processing industry preferred, or a combination of 5+ years of relevant education and related manufacturing or quality experience.

Experience with external relationships and communications, whether with suppliers or customers, is preferred.
Lean/Black Belt certification.

Proficiency in Lean Manufacturing tools, including Value Stream Mapping, identification of the 8 forms of waste, and expertise in 5S+1 methodologies.

A solid understanding of Design of Experiments.
Strong knowledge and background in statistics, SPC/SQC, process control, 8D methodology, metrology, and Chemistry. Familiarity with Six Sigma tools for variability reduction and process enhancement.
Ability to design and develop mechanical systems and equipment.
Experience in developing and executing qualification requirements and plans.
Experience in implementing and supporting automation solutions.
Experience in inspecting and testing equipment, both contact and non-contact.
